Matt Conroy
2025 James Beard Foundation “Best Chef Mid-Atlantic” semifinalist Chef Matt Conroy, is the award-winning chef behind three of D.C.'s best restaurants, Pascual, Lutèce, and just-opened Maison Bar à Vins. Pascual, the hearth-focused Mexican restaurant he opened in 2024 with The Popal Group (TPG) alongside spouse Chef Isabel Coss, received national “Best New Restaurant” recognition in Eater, The New York Times, Robb Report, and the #1 spot in The Washington Post. Lutèce, TPG's French neo-bistro in Georgetown, is a New York Times “America’s Best Restaurants” 2022, Washingtonian's current #13 “Very Best” Restaurant, a multi-time "RAMMY" award-winner, and one of RESY's "Top 100 Restaurants" for '25. His most recent opening alongside TPG, Maison Bar à Vins, is a European-style wine bar + restaurant set in a three-story, historic brownstone in Adams Morgan. Maison was included in Robb Report and The Infatuation's lists of the Most Exciting Restaurant Openings in America.
Trained first in classical French cuisine followed by Mexican cuisine, Conroy’s passion is creating modern dishes full of flavor using seasonal, high-quality, local ingredients paired with sustainable, natural wines. After rising through the culinary ranks in Boston and Vermont starting at age fifteen, Conroy moved to New York City to work at Alex Stuptak’s Empellón Cocina. His tenure at Empellón was formative as he perfected his Mexican cuisine and met Coss. From there, he became Executive Chef of Little Prince in NYC where he developed his passion for the new wave of modern French dining, the “neo-bistro.” In 2018, Conroy opened his passion project in Brooklyn, Oxomoco, alongside Chef Justin Bazdarich. Oxomoco gained popularity for its wood-fired Mexican fare, earning the team a MICHELIN star in 2019 and landing Conroy as a StarChefs Rising Stars award winner. In 2020, Conroy made the move to Washington, DC, to become the Executive Chef of Lutèce and later open Pascual.
